What is the Student Employee Payroll Direct Deposit Authorization Form?
The Student Employee Payroll Direct Deposit Authorization Form serves a critical function for student employees at Boston University by enabling them to set up direct deposit for their earnings. This form simplifies paycheck access, ensuring students receive their funds in a timely manner through direct deposit. Key fields included in the form encompass NAME, B.U. ID NUMBER, BANK NAME, ACCOUNT NUMBER, and ROUTING NUMBER, which are essential for processing payroll accurately.

How to Fill Out the Student Employee Payroll Direct Deposit Authorization Form Online
Filling out the Student Employee Payroll Direct Deposit Authorization Form online is a straightforward process. Start by gathering essential information, including your Bank Name, Account Number, and Routing Number. Each of these sections must be completed accurately to facilitate correct deposit processing.
When you fill out the form, ensure you attach a voided check, which will help validate your banking information. After completing the form, double-check all details to confirm they are correct before submission. This attention to detail helps prevent delays in accessing your payroll funds.
Common Mistakes to Avoid When Completing the Form
Completing the Direct Deposit Authorization Form accurately is critical to prevent payment issues. Common mistakes include entering incorrect account numbers, missing signatures, and failing to attach necessary documents like a voided check. Review the form thoroughly before submission to mitigate these errors.
-
Check all entries for accuracy, particularly account details.
-
Ensure required fields are fully completed.
-
Attach a voided check to avoid banking discrepancies.
Utilizing a validation checklist can significantly reduce the likelihood of errors, ensuring all necessary steps are followed before submission.

Who is eligible to use the Student Employee Payroll Direct Deposit Authorization Form?
The form is specifically designed for student employees of Boston University who need to set up direct deposit for their paychecks.
What should I attach to the form?
You should attach a voided check to the form to verify your bank account information and ensure proper direct deposit setup.
How do I submit the completed form?
Once you have completed and signed the form, submit it according to your payroll department's specific instructions, which may include electronic submission through pdfFiller or a physical drop-off.
What common mistakes should I av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include entering incorrect bank details or omitting required fields, such as your NAME or B.U. ID NUMBER. Always double-check your information.
How long will it take for the direct deposit to start?
Processing times vary, but typically allow a few business days after submission for the direct deposit to be set up and reflected in your pay schedule.
Is notarization required for this form?
No, the Student Employee Payroll Direct Deposit Authorization Form does not require notarization.
Can I make changes to my direct deposit information later?
Yes, if you need to update your direct deposit information in the future, you will need to complete a new Student Employee Payroll Direct Deposit Authorization Form.
